Axos (AX) earnings outlook | growth forecasts, market sentiment, and institutional demand. Axos Financial Inc. (AX)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$2.53, surpassing the consensus estimate of $2.1815 by a margin of 15.98%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in this release, and the stock experienced a modest decline of 0.72% on the announcement. The sharp EPS beat underscores strong underlying profitability but was unable to prevent a slightly negative market reaction.

Axos Financial’s first-quarter results were driven by robust net interest income and disciplined expense management, leading to the substantial EPS surprise. The company’s diversified digital banking platform likely contributed to higher fee-based income and improved net interest margins, though specific segment-level data were not provided. As a nationally chartered digital bank, Axos benefits from a low-cost deposit base and a growing loan portfolio, both of which may have supported the earnings outperformance. The provision for credit losses and loan growth trends remain key operational metrics, but without revenue disclosure, investors must rely on the EPS figure as the primary indicator of operating strength. The reported EPS of $2.53 represents a significant jump from prior quarters, reflecting effective cost controls and possibly higher non-interest income. Management’s focus on technology-driven efficiencies and customer acquisition appears to be paying off, although the absence of revenue details limits a full operational assessment. The stock’s 0.72% decline following the release suggests that the market may have already priced in a strong quarter, or that the absence of revenue data and guidance left some uncertainty. Analysts are likely to revise upward their near-term EPS estimates given the magnitude of the beat, but the lack of revenue visibility may temper enthusiasm. Investment implications hinge on whether Axos can sustain its margin advantage and generate consistent income growth. Key factors to watch in the next quarter include net interest margin trends, loan growth, and credit metrics. The cautious price action implies that investors may be waiting for more clarity on the top-line trajectory before re-rating the stock.
